What is a Mobility Scooter?
A mobility scooter is a motorized automobile made for people with physical limitations. It assists users keep their mobility and self-reliance, providing an efficient methods of transportation over short ranges. While they may look comparable to small electric automobiles, mobility scooters are generally powered by batteries, with controls designed for ease of usage.
Kinds Of Mobility Scooters
There are several kinds of mobility scooters available in the market, each created to cater to various requirements and preferences. Here's a breakdown of the most common types:
Type of Mobility ScooterDescriptionBest ForThree-Wheeled ScootersThese scooters offer exceptional maneuverability and small turning radius however may lack stability.Indoor use and tight areas.Four-Wheeled ScootersFrequently more stable than three-wheeled models, these scooters are best for outside use.All-terrain travel and outside activities.Portable ScootersLightweight and collapsible, these scooters are designed for simple transportation.Travelers and people with restricted storage space.Sturdy ScootersDeveloped for larger users, these are robust and can handle much heavier weights, typically geared up with better battery life.Users requiring extra assistance and stability.Feature-Rich ScootersThese may include innovative innovation such as Bluetooth connection, built-in GPS, and adjustable seating.Tech-savvy users looking for convenience and benefit.Key Features of Mobility Scooters
When picking a mobility scooter, buyers need to consider a number of necessary functions. The following list outlines crucial elements that can greatly affect their experience:
Weight Capacity: Understanding the scooter's weight limitation is essential to guarantee safety and efficiency.Battery Life: A longer battery life translates to more extended usage between charges, which is vital for prolonged journeys.Speed: Typical mobility scooters can reach speeds in between 4 to 8 miles per hour, however it's necessary to pick one that suits the user's requirements.Convenience: Look for adjustable seats, armrests, and back-rests that improve the overall riding experience.Mobility: If traveling often, a lightweight and collapsible scooter is useful.Terrain Capability: Some scooters are better geared up for rough surfaces, while others work best on smooth surfaces.Advantages of Using Mobility Scooters

Factors to consider Before Purchase
Before selecting the best mobility scooter, possible buyers ought to keep these factors to consider in mind:
Lifestyle Needs: Assess how the scooter will suit day-to-day routines, including the frequency and locations of use.Trial Rides: If possible, taking a couple of designs for a test drive can assist gauge comfort and maneuverability.Spending plan: Costs can differ widely, so specifying a budget upfront is vital.Service warranty and Service: Always consider the warranty offered and the availability of customer care in case of repair work.FAQs About Mobility Scooters1. How quick do mobility scooters go?
Mobility scooters typically vary from 4 to 8 miles per hour, depending upon the design and its power capability.
2. Are mobility scooters covered by insurance?
Lots of insurance coverage plans may cover part of the cost if a doctor recommends the scooter; however, policies vary substantially.
3. Can I drive a mobility scooter on the road?
This depends on regional laws and guidelines. In some locations, mobility scooters may be allowed on public roadways, while in others, they are restricted to pathways and paths.
4. The length of time does the battery last?
Battery life normally depends on the scooter design and type of use. Typical mobility scooter batteries can last anywhere from 6 to 12 miles on a single charge.
5. Are mobility scooters safe?
Mobility scooters are generally safe when utilized appropriately. It's vital to acquaint oneself with the controls and operate them properly.
